Allan R. Hyde, 78, of DeKalb, Illinois, passed away on Wednesday, March 25, 2026, while on vacation in Panama City, Florida. Though his passing was unexpected, he leaves behind a lifetime of memories filled with laughter, love, and strong connections with family and friends.


Allan was born on June 18, 1947, in Urbana, Illinois, to Russell and Margaret (Kopp) Hyde. Later in life, he found love and companionship with Faye Harris, whom he married on November 24, 2012, in Bootjack, Michigan. Together, they shared years of love, laughter, and companionship.


He proudly served his country in the United States Air Force, serving in the Vietnam War, something he carried with quiet pride throughout his life. Allan spent 32 years as a mail carrier in DeKalb, a job that allowed him to connect with so many people in the community he loved. He was also a long-time delivery driver for Pizza Villa and delivered parts for Bumper to Bumper. Even beyond that, he was never one to sit still—always working, always helping, and always staying busy.


Allan had a true passion for hot rods and car shows, where he found not just a hobby, but a community. Some of his happiest moments were spent with his car buddies, especially during Sunday morning gatherings at Rise N Shine Restaurant in Sycamore. Those mornings were more than just coffee—they were friendship, laughter, and tradition. He was also a proud member of the Road Angels and the Sycamore VFW.
